Background

Minimum Essential Media (MEM) In Hanks’ Buffer is a modification of Basal Medium Eagle. It was originally developed by Harry Eagle for specific  requirements of certain subtypes. Additionally, it includes higher concentrations of amino acids which is more suitable for cultured mammalian cells. Moreover, PurMa Biologics manufactures MEM with Earle’s buffer for use in a CO2 incubator, or with Hanks’ salts for use without CO2.

PurMa MEM media in Hank’s buffer includes Hank’s buffer

Hanks buffer, it contains:

  1. Potassium Chloride
  2. Potassium Phosphate, monobasic
  3. Sodium Bicarbonate
  4. Sodium Chloride
  5. Sodium Phosphate, dibasic

Additionally, Minimum Essential Media (MEM) In Hanks’ Buffer contains:

  • Low level of glucose (1.00 g/ liter)
  • Sodium bicarbonate (0.35 g/L). If , however, higher than 5% CO2 is used, a higher % of sodium bicarbonate is needed.
  • 2 mM L-glutamine (292 mg/L)

Applications

Minimum Essential Media MEM has been used for the cultivation of a wide variety of cells grown in monolayers attached or in suspension cell lines such as HeLa, BHK-21, 293, HEP-2, HT-1080, MCF-7, and fibroblasts as well as primary rat astrocytes. MEM contains no proteins, lipids, or growth factors. Therefore, MEM requires supplementation, commonly with 10% fetal bovine serum (FBS).

Frequently asked questions

How should I store Minimum Essential Media (MEM) In Hanks’ Buffer?

Store at 2 to 8 degrees C, protected from light, and do not freeze unless the label states otherwise. Freezing can precipitate salts and degrade light sensitive components such as riboflavin and folic acid. Always follow the storage line on the Certificate of Analysis for the specific lot.

What is the shelf life once opened?

Unopened and correctly stored, the typical shelf life is 12 months from manufacture. Once opened, use within about four weeks and always handle in a laminar flow hood, since the practical limit after opening is contamination risk rather than chemical stability.

Is it sterility and endotoxin tested?

Yes. Every lot is sterile filtered and tested for sterility and endotoxin, and a Certificate of Analysis is issued for each lot. The COA is available on request for any catalogue number.

Do I need to add L-glutamine?

It depends on the formulation you order. Standard formulations may contain free L-glutamine, which degrades in solution over time, while MAX formulations use a stable L-alanyl-L-glutamine dipeptide that does not require fresh supplementation. Check the option you have selected before adding more.
